Description
AdvantaTM is Gennum's premium high-end product with
ADRO technology from Dynamic Hearing implemented
on the VoyageurTM platform. The flexibility and
sophistication of ADRO combines with the precision
and advanced capabilities of Voyageur to deliver
unprecedented sound quality, comfort and audibility to
hearing aid wearers.
ADRO is fitted via direct in-situ measures to ensure a
fast, customised fitting. ADRO uses statistical analysis
and gain customized in 32 independent channels, so
that the sound level is always optimized to be within the
comfortable dynamic range of the listener.
Advanta's adaptive directional microphone technology
provides added benefit in background noise. Advanta
automatically changes from directional to
omni-directional in different environments as needed.
Advanta has an adjustable threshold criterion and
becomes omni-directional in wind noise, and in quiet. In
the directional mode, the signals from two
omni-directional microphones are combined and the
null is automatically moved to optimise noise rejection.
The adaptive directional microphone features a flat
frequency response, so that no additional frequency
compensation is required. It is easily configured for
different microphone placements, and can be calibrated
to match multiple microphones.
The advanced feedback canceller provides increased
maximum stable gain. Additionally, it features rapid
adjustment for dynamic feedback situations.
Advanta is available with the ConfigureTM fitting
software, so named as it allows the customer to quickly
configure the hearing aid. Configure features a
stand-alone database supporting multiple sessions,
automatic interface detection and an intuitive fitting
procedure which achieves fast and accurate fittings. A
software interface library for customers wishing to
integrate support for Advanta into existing fitting
software is also available.
Other configurable options on Advanta include: fixed
directional microphone, internal noise reduction with
user programmable settings, direct audio input, telecoil
input, calibration and test modes supporting standard
IEC/ANSI procedures, adjustable input selection, and
four listening programs.
